Stuart Weitzman Armor Flat: You’ve Got Chain Mail

Stuart Weitzman Armor Flat

Want shoes that can really protect your feet from the elements? All you need is a little chain mail! That’s Stuart Weitzman’s method anyway on the aptly named armor flat ($375 at Neiman Marcus). But don’t worry – the effect is more razzle dazzle ‘em than Joan of Arc riding into battle. The almost sandals are perfect for a vacation to the tropics (and if you don’t already have one planned, here’s a great excuse!). The raffia-trimmed flats can transition from beachside to dinner to dance floor, minimizing all of those fussy outfit changes. Here are three looks to try out on your seaside getaway:

Beachy Nautical: Spending the day on a yacht? Go sailor style in this Michael Kors striped top ($1,050 at Neiman Marcus) and white skinnies ($495 at Neiman Marcus). With the sparkly Stuarts, you’ll completely bypass any chance of taking the nautical theme over the top.

Day to Night Dress: For day to night shoes, you need an equally versatile dress! T Bags twist-waist maxi ($202 at Neiman Marcus) is boho beachy, and I love the zebra-print. You can dress it up or down with a simple change in jewelry.

Easy, Flirty Skirt:Markus Lupfer’s pleated mini ($300 on NET-A-PORTER) is a cute, convenient skirt to throw on after a light swim. The gray jersey material will dry quickly in the sun, making this an everyday look that’s effortless and versatile.
